1730 E 14th St #1C, Brooklyn, NY 11229 is a 1 bedroom, 1 bathroom apartment in Sheepshead Bay. More recently, it was listed as a rental in August 2024 with an asking price of $2,300 per month. That rental listing was removed on September 13, 2024. This property is not currently displayed as for sale or rent on Trulia. The Trulia Estimate rent is $1,928/month.
